According to registered dietitian Julie Upton, R.D., C.S.D., water diets are simply another word for fasting. When water is your main (or only) source of nutrition, your body loses important nutrients. According to Upton, the short-term outcome is that you will lose a lot of weight, the majority of which will be water rather than fat. You run the danger of dehydration if you don’t drink enough water when fasting.
